Hospital Inpatient Detoxification - Drug and Alcohol Rehabilitation Centers - Belle Plaine, KS.

Detoxification is the first stage of getting off of drugs and alcohol, and you could decide to undergo detox in a hospital inpatient detox center for several reasons. Hospital inpatient detoxification in Belle Plaine offers medically managed detox, which is carried out with the assistance of nurses and doctors who can make drug withdrawal more comfortable, using medications to ease symptoms and even make detox safer. A person withdrawing from alcohol for example might benefit from specific medications during detox to prevent seizures that commonly occur with severe alcohol withdrawal. A person who is going through heroin or prescription opioid withdrawal will most likely choose to take part in medically supervised detoxification in a hospital inpatient facility, where medications are utilized to help them through a very discomforting (but usually not life threatening) form of withdrawal. Patients in a hospital inpatient detoxification facility remain at the facility until the symptoms of withdrawal have subsided. This may be anywhere from 1 to 2 weeks depending on what type of substance they are withdrawing from and their overall health.

For a person who has been struggling with substance abuse issues for some time, the recommendation would be a quick and smooth transition from a hospital inpatient detoxification facility to a drug and/or alcohol recovery facility to handle their addiction because detox is not rehabilitation in itself.
